About H. P. Lovecraft

American author (1890-1937) of weird fiction, born in Providence, RI. He popularized cosmicism, emphasizing humanity's insignificance. Creator of the Cthulhu Mythos, his tales often explore forbidden knowledge. He was central to the "Lovecraft Circle" and published in Weird Tales.
